Table Of Contentsclose
    Planet

    Java Development Services

    Leverage the power of Java with our expert Java development services. Partner with us to build robust, scalable, and high-performance software solutions that are tailored to meet your unique business needs.

    Let's talk

    Trusted by industry leaders, enterprises, and funded startups

    Home > Technologies > Java Development Services

    Why Java Is a Go-To Language for Software Development

    Java remains a popular choice for software development due to its platform independence, robustness, and extensive community support. It enables developers to build versatile applications that run seamlessly across various environments, from mobile devices to enterprise servers.

    Java's object-oriented programming model provides a clear modular structure, enhancing code reusability and maintainability, which is crucial for building scalable and secure applications. With a vast ecosystem of libraries and frameworks, Java accelerates the development process, reduces time to market, and ensures the delivery of high-quality software solutions. Its strong emphasis on security and performance makes Java an ideal choice for businesses looking to develop reliable, efficient, and future-proof applications.

    Why Python is Crucial for Business Software Development?

    Python offers a range of advantages that make it indispensable for developing business software:

    Versatility Across Industries

    Python is adaptable to various industries, from finance to healthcare, making it a powerful tool for diverse business needs.

    Strong Community Support

    With a large and active community, Python provides access to extensive resources, updates, and third-party tools, ensuring your software stays cutting-edge.

    Enhanced Collaboration

    Python’s clear syntax and readability make it easier for teams to collaborate, reducing development time and minimizing errors.

    Future-Proofing

    Python’s continuous evolution and support for emerging technologies like AI and machine learning ensure your software remains relevant in the rapidly changing digital landscape.

    Java Development Services We Offer

    We offer a comprehensive range of Java development services tailored to meet your specific business requirements. Discover the Java solutions we can build for you:

    Custom Java Application Development

    Custom Java Application Development

    Our team specializes in developing custom Java applications that are tailored to your business's unique needs. We focus on creating scalable, flexible solutions that integrate seamlessly with your existing infrastructure. Our custom development services prioritize enhancing operational efficiency, driving innovation, and achieving your long-term business goals.

    Java Web Development
    Java Web Development

    We build robust, secure, and high-performance web applications using Java frameworks like Spring and Hibernate. Our web development services focus on delivering exceptional user experiences with responsive design, intuitive navigation, and advanced functionality, ensuring your web applications are both visually appealing and highly efficient.

    Enterprise Java Development

    Enterprise Java Development

    We develop comprehensive, scalable, and secure enterprise software solutions using Java, designed to meet the specific needs of large organizations. Our enterprise development services focus on integrating various business processes, enhancing communication, and improving overall productivity across departments.

    Java Mobile Application Development
    Java Mobile Application Development

    Our Java mobile application development services leverage the power of Java to build robust, user-friendly mobile apps for Android devices. Using frameworks like Android SDK and JavaFX, we develop applications that offer high performance, security, and scalability. Whether you need a consumer-facing app or an enterprise-grade solution, our team ensures your mobile application is optimized for both functionality and user experience.

    Java API Development
    Java API Development

    We specialize in creating scalable, secure APIs using Java, enhancing your software’s interoperability with third-party services and applications. Our API development services ensure seamless data exchange and integration, enabling your applications to expand their functionality and provide a richer user experience. By using RESTful and SOAP-based approaches, we ensure your APIs are robust, reliable, and easy to integrate with existing systems.

    Java Microservices Development

    Java Microservices Development

    Our team excels in developing microservices architectures using Java, which allows businesses to build scalable and modular applications. Java microservices enable efficient deployment, better fault isolation, and more straightforward maintenance, reducing overall operational costs. Our expertise in frameworks like Spring Boot and Docker ensures a smooth transition to microservices architecture, fostering agility and innovation.

    Java Cloud Application Development
    Java Cloud Application Development

    We provide Java cloud application development services that help businesses harness the power of cloud computing. Utilizing Java’s platform independence, we create cloud-native applications that are scalable, resilient, and easy to manage. Whether deploying to AWS, Azure, or Google Cloud, our solutions ensure seamless integration with cloud services, enhancing your application's performance and scalability.

    Java Maintenance and Support
    Java Maintenance and Support

    Our commitment to your success doesn’t end at deployment. We offer ongoing maintenance and support services to ensure your Java applications remain secure, up-to-date, and fully functional. Our services include regular updates, bug fixes, performance optimization, and technical support to keep your software running smoothly as your business evolves.

    Our Java Development Process

    We follow a structured and agile process to deliver high-quality Java development solutions that align with your business goals. Here’s how we ensure your project’s success:

    1. Discovery and Analysis

    We begin by understanding your business objectives, challenges, and specific requirements. This phase involves in-depth consultations to gather all necessary information and define the project scope, ensuring a clear roadmap for development.

    2. Design

    Our team creates detailed software designs and architecture plans that outline the structure and user experience of your Java application. We focus on creating intuitive, user-friendly interfaces and scalable architecture that meets your specific needs and future growth.

    3. Development

    Using agile methodologies, our Java developers build your application in iterative cycles, allowing for flexibility and continuous improvement. Regular sprints and feedback loops ensure that the development stays on track and aligns with your evolving requirements.

    4. Testing and Quality Assurance

    We conduct comprehensive testing throughout the development process, including unit tests, integration tests, and user acceptance tests, to identify and fix any issues early. Our rigorous QA processes ensure that the final product is reliable, secure, and meets the highest quality standards.

    5. Deployment and Integration

    Once the application is fully developed and tested, we deploy it in your chosen environment. We ensure seamless integration with existing systems, minimizing downtime and ensuring a smooth transition to the new software.

    6. Post-Launch Support and Maintenance

    Our relationship doesn’t end at deployment. We provide ongoing support, including regular updates, bug fixes, performance optimization, and enhancements, to keep your Java application secure, up-to-date, and fully functional.

    Success Stories

    Clients Put Their Trust In Us

    Left Arrow
    Left Arrow

    Why Choose Us for Java Development?

    Choosing us for your Java development needs means partnering with a team dedicated to delivering quality, expertise, and a client-focused approach. Here’s what makes us stand out:

    Expert Java Developers
    Expert Python Developers

    Our skilled Java developers have extensive experience in building scalable and high-performance applications. We stay current with the latest Java advancements, ensuring your projects utilize the most efficient and secure solutions.

    Custom-Tailored Solutions
    Custom-Tailored Solutions

    We offer bespoke Java development solutions designed to align with your business goals. Our flexible approach ensures the final product meets your specific requirements and adds maximum value to your organization.

    Agile Development Approach
    Agile Development Approach

    By using agile methodologies, we provide flexibility and quick adaptation to changes, ensuring timely delivery and client satisfaction. Our iterative process allows for continuous improvement, keeping your project aligned with your evolving needs.

    Comprehensive Java Development Services
    Comprehensive Java Development Services

    From concept to deployment and support, we provide full-cycle Java development services. This comprehensive approach ensures seamless delivery and solutions that cater to your unique business requirements.

    Quality and Security Focus
    Quality and Security Focus

    We prioritize quality and security in all our development practices. With rigorous coding standards, thorough testing, and strong security measures, we ensure your Java applications are reliable, secure, and performant.

    Helping You Make The Right Choices

    Frequently Asked Questions

    Why should I choose Java for my software development project?

    Java is a versatile, secure, and high-performance language that is ideal for a wide range of applications, from web and mobile apps to enterprise solutions. Its platform independence, extensive library support, and active community make it a reliable choice for businesses looking to build scalable and robust applications.

    Get in touch

    Ready to elevate your business with our expert Java development services? Contact us today to discuss your project needs and discover how we can help you build high-performance, scalable, and secure Java applications tailored to your specific requirements.